Ranasan Census 2011: Key Statistics and Insights
As per the 2011 Census, Ranasan Village has a population of 2.15 k (2,146) with 1.08 k (1,084) males and 1.06 k (1,062) females.The sex ratio in Ranasan is 980, indicating an above-average ratio compared to the national average of 943 .
Child Population (Age group 0-6 years) of Ranasan Village is 251 (251) which is 11.7% of Ranasan Village overall population, Child sex Ratio of Ranasan Village is 1008 females for every 1000 males.
Note : In the 2011 Census, Ranasan village is listed as part of the Chanasma Subdistrict (Tahsil) of the Patan District in the state of GUJARAT in INDIA.

Ranasan Literacy Rate
Ranasan Village has a literacy rate of 91.29% which is higher than national average of 72.98%, The Male literacy rate of Ranasan Village is 96.35 higher than national average of 80.88%, The Female literacy rate of Ranasan Village is 86.11 higher than national average of 64.63%.

Ranasan Scheduled Castes (SC) Population
Scheduled Castes(SC) Population in Ranasan Village is 269 (269) with 134 (134) males and 135 (135) females, which is 12.53% of Ranasan Village overall population. The Sex Ratio among Scheduled Caste is 1008 females for every 1000 males.
Ranasan Scheduled Tribes (ST) Population
Scheduled Tribes(ST) Population in Ranasan Village is 10 (10) with 4 (4) males and 6 (6) females, which is 0.47% of Ranasan Village overall population. The Sex Ratio among Scheduled Tribes is 1500 females for every 1000 males.

Ranasan Workforce (Worker Profile) Overview
In Ranasan Village, there are about 990 (990) workers, making up nearly 46.13% of the Ranasan Village total population. Out of these, around 631 (631) are male workers, and about 359 (359) are female workers.
